2012-11-14 17 views
12

की चौड़ाई निर्धारित करना मैं केंडो यूआई के एमवीसी रैपर का उपयोग कर रहा हूं और मैं पॉपअप की चौड़ाई निर्धारित नहीं कर सकता। मैंने दो तरीकों की कोशिश की है और कोई भी काम नहीं कर रहा है। यहाँ मैं क्या करने की कोशिश की है या नहीं:केंडो यूआई ग्रिड पॉपअप (एमवीसी)

.Editable(edit => edit.Mode(GridEditMode.Popup) 
    .TemplateName("Create") 
    .Window(w => w.Title("Add Interruption") 
     .Name("addInterruption") 
     .Width(700))) 

और

.Editable(edit => edit.Mode(GridEditMode.Popup) 
    .TemplateName("Create") 
    .Window(w => w.Title("Add Interruption") 
     .Name("addInterruption") 
     .HtmlAttributes(new { style="width:700px;" }))) 

ऊंचाई या तो काम नहीं करता।

आप पॉपअप विंडो की चौड़ाई कैसे सेट करते हैं? धन्यवाद!

अद्यतन:

.k-edit-form-container { width: auto;} 

यह kendo.common.min.css फ़ाइल में पाया जाता है: किसी और को इस के साथ संघर्ष कर के लिए, यहाँ ठीक है।

उत्तर

8

अफसोस की बात है कि आपने अपने दोनों स्निपेट में लागू सेटिंग्स को क्रमबद्ध नहीं किया है और अजाक्स बाध्यकारी (सर्वर बाध्यकारी के बारे में भी सुनिश्चित नहीं) का उपयोग करते समय विंडो पर लागू नहीं किया गया है।

मूल रूप से चौड़ाई सेट करने के लिए मैं सुझाव है कि आप निम्नलिखित जावास्क्रिप्ट का उपयोग करने के, जब पेज लोड किया गया है:

$("#NameOfTheGrid").data().kendoGrid.options.editable.window.width = "1000px"; 
+1

सहायता की सराहना करें! इच्छा है कि वे एक अद्यतन करेंगे क्योंकि मुझे यकीन है कि बहुत से लोग इसके लिए चिल्ला रहे हैं। – SFAgitator

+0

कृपया मुझे 'स्क्रीनिंग' भीड़ में जोड़ें। शुरूआत से एक टेलीरिक एमवीसी उपयोगकर्ता रहा है और केंडो यूआई एमवीसी फ्रंट पर होने वाले काम की कमी से थोड़ा निराश है। – Uchitha

6

मेरे लिए, जब सर्वर मोड में बाध्यकारी

.k-edit-form-container { width: auto;} 

की जरूरत थी। मैंने इसे केंडो सीएसएस फ़ाइल को संपादित करने के बजाय दृश्य में एक शैली के रूप में जोड़ा है।

अन्य जवाब है,

$("#NameOfTheGrid").data().kendoGrid.options.editable.window.width = "1000px"; 

ajax बाध्यकारी लेकिन सर्वर से आबद्ध नहीं के साथ महान काम किया।

+0

.k-edit-form-container {width: auto;} मेरे लिए महत्वपूर्ण था, अन्यथा यह स्क्रीन को चौड़ा कर रहा था और अभी भी मेरा लंबा टेक्स्ट तोड़ रहा था। धन्यवाद मालिक! – Contristo

संबंधित मुद्दे